Definition
Veined: marked by visible lines or patterns resembling veins, often used to describe the appearance of materials or skin.
Sample Sentences
- The marble countertop was beautifully veined, showcasing intricate patterns of white and gray.
- Her hands were veined with blue lines, a testament to her fair complexion and thin skin.
- The artist used veined paper for his sketches, adding a unique texture to his work.
- In the autumn, the leaves of the maple tree turned a vibrant red, with their veins standing out prominently.
- The geologist examined the rock, noting the veined mineral deposits that hinted at its formation history.
